Mark Whittaker appointed as sales manager for LBE and FECs at Simworx |
|
17 Jul 2019 . BY Lauren Heath-Jones |
|
|
|
|
|
Mark Whittaker has worked in the attractions industry for more than 15 years |
|
Simworx, a UK-based dynamic media-based attractions manufacturer, has appointed Mark Whittaker to the role of sales manager for Family Entertainment Centres (FECs) and Location-Based Entertainment (LBE) venues, following significant growth and demand from these sectors over the past year.
Something of an industry veteran, having worked in the attractions industry for more than 15 years, Whittaker, who has previously served as sales manager for both the Immotion Group and Elton Amusements, will be responsible for expanding Simworx' FEC/LBE product range as well promoting existing products, such as the Immersive Adventurer and 4D theatre.
Whittaker said: "I'm really happy to be joining Simworx, it's a company I have always had a lot of admiration for. I'm looking forward to showing everyone what we have to offer."
Simworx has recently installed a number of FEC-friendly attractions at the National Geographic Ultimate Expedition Centres in China and Mexico, and has installed its 4D Cinema attractions at the Nickelodeon Adventure FECs in Madrid and Murcia.
